PSA: if you have Raynaud’s Syndrome, #Raynauds, then you have dysautonomia — it’s a form a #dysautonomia
New research: “Raynaud’s syndrome is a common dysautonomia where exposure to cold increases the vascular tone of distal arteries causing vasoconstriction and hypoxia particularly in the extremities. Our results indicate that Raynaud’s syndrome is related to vascular function mediated by adrenergic signaling through ADRA2A.“
